Output d3da7c05edb42e3c839eccbe673425cd3b65754fea30a7f2efdc75f4ed04ba5e:0

value
138639
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d185c115624ebcd2fb93106b1653fd84f74c51e32b70622532442363dc5bcf84
address
bc1p6xzuz9tzf67d97unzp43v5lasnm5c50r9dcxyffjgs3k8hzme7zq84csng
transaction
d3da7c05edb42e3c839eccbe673425cd3b65754fea30a7f2efdc75f4ed04ba5e
confirmations
616
spent
true